Most property owners do not register snow as a structural threat until the ceiling stains appear or the repair estimate lands on the table. That is exactly when the damage is already done. Wet, compacted snow applies relentless downward force on your roofing system, stressing decking, fatiguing joints, and setting the stage for ice dams to take hold. Ice dams form when heat escaping your home melts snow on the upper roof, sending water running toward the colder eaves where it refreezes and builds a barrier. That barrier traps further meltwater, drives it beneath your shingles, and delivers it straight into your insulation, framing, and finished interiors. Mold follows.
